I noticed when going thru my manual, that I have a front baggage compartment light. I have been going thru and checking / replacing various bulbs. Sure enough, the light didn't work. It turns out the bulb was ok. Where is the switch for that light? I saw the decal that says the door must be fully open for it to work. I have a RAT backup alternator on that door, so they may have [re]moved something when installing that.
